Transaction 176fdda49f2ac7c34067a43452efa66f28fc640aa54d16755017f4a59756cc00
1 Input
2 Outputs
- 176fdda49f2ac7c34067a43452efa66f28fc640aa54d16755017f4a59756cc00:0
- 176fdda49f2ac7c34067a43452efa66f28fc640aa54d16755017f4a59756cc00:1
value 1885000
address 1ExFSXiKiqMDDxRyVgrQ7SvZEgBRTa78tb
value 47554475
address 1HbYDDMvTvsznD2LpgzKSZSKWoxvGzDL93